The Mexico Facility Management (FM) market is experiencing robust growth, driven by increasing urbanization, a burgeoning commercial real estate sector, and a rising demand for efficient and cost-effective operational solutions across various industries. The market, valued at approximately $XX million in 2025 (assuming a logical estimation based on the provided CAGR and study period), is projected to maintain a Compound Annual Growth Rate (CAGR) of 7.23% from 2025 to 2033. This growth is fueled by several key factors, including the expanding presence of multinational corporations in Mexico, the rising adoption of smart building technologies enhancing operational efficiency, and a growing preference for outsourcing FM services to specialized providers. The preference for outsourcing allows businesses to focus on their core competencies while leveraging the expertise of professional FM companies. Further, government initiatives promoting sustainable building practices are likely to boost the demand for environmentally conscious FM solutions.
The market is segmented by facility management type (in-house vs. outsourced), offering (hard FM vs. soft FM), and end-user (commercial, institutional, public/infrastructure, industrial). The outsourced segment holds a significant market share due to its cost-effectiveness and access to specialized skills. Within offerings, Hard FM (covering building maintenance, repairs, and operations) currently dominates, but soft FM (covering cleaning, security, and catering) is expected to witness faster growth due to increased focus on employee well-being and productivity within workplaces. The commercial sector is a major contributor to market revenue, followed by institutional and public/infrastructure segments, reflecting ongoing expansion of commercial spaces and investments in public infrastructure. Key players like Johnson Controls, Sodexo, Compass Group, JLL, CBRE, Cushman & Wakefield, ISS Mexico, and Serco are vying for market share, with competition largely focused on providing innovative solutions, cost optimization, and superior service delivery.

Dominant Regions, Countries, or Segments in Mexico Facility Management Market
The Commercial segment is currently the largest segment of the Mexican facility management market, driven by high demand for efficient and cost-effective solutions from large corporations and businesses. Outsourcing facility management (xx Million in 2025) also shows significant growth compared to Inhouse Facility Management (xx Million in 2025). Within offerings, Hard FM is a larger segment than Soft FM, reflecting the robust construction and industrial activity in the country. Geographically, major metropolitan areas such as Mexico City, Guadalajara, and Monterrey are driving market growth due to high concentration of commercial and industrial facilities.
